Question Strange reciprocal vibration in a punto - help

Given the vast combined knowledge of cars here I thought I'd ask this because I'm confused and she's worried about it.

The girlfriends punto (55S) has developped a strange vibration, you can feel it from 20mph or so and it just gets worse, feels like it is going to shake itself apart once over 70mph, not that you'd want to do much more in the car!

Initially thought it was very badly out of balence wheels (fronts presumably), so had them done. They wern't good, improved when the original weights were taken off(???!!!) and are now fine.

As a rotational thing there aren't that many things that it could be. I thought of thaking it to a tyre place that does on car balencing to see if that can track it down.

Any other thoughts or suggestions gratefully received.
